KFFB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2023 in Review

16 of the 6,283 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Kentucky First Federal Bancorp (KFFB) for Q1 2023, worth a combined $1.87M — up 42% from $1.32M a quarter earlier.

Fund positioning in KFFB was balanced in Q1 2023: 2 funds opened new positions, 2 closed out, 4 added to existing stakes and 3 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Community Trust & Investment, opening a new position worth an estimated $135K. The largest seller was BHZ Capital Management, cutting an estimated $63K.
